Boolean Search

Boolean Search is a technique used in information retrieval that allows users to combine keywords with operators such as AND, OR, and NOT to produce more relevant search results. This method provides a refined and precise way to query databases, search engines, and digital libraries by defining explicit relationships between search terms. It enhances the ability to filter and narrow down results based on specific criteria, making it an invaluable tool for research and data analysis.

The power of Boolean search lies in its flexibility and precision. By strategically using Boolean operators, users can exclude irrelevant information, combine related keywords, and create complex search queries that yield highly targeted results. This method is particularly useful in environments where large volumes of data need to be sifted through, such as academic research, competitive intelligence, and digital marketing analytics. It allows for a nuanced approach to information discovery that goes beyond simple keyword matching.

In the context of digital marketing and SEO, Boolean search techniques are often employed to conduct detailed competitive analyses, monitor brand mentions, and uncover industry trends. Marketers use these techniques to gather insights from various data sources, ensuring that their strategies are informed by a comprehensive understanding of the competitive landscape. Ultimately, Boolean search enhances the efficiency and effectiveness of research by enabling users to quickly identify the most relevant data points within vast datasets.
